A Guided Path Through Reinvention
2nd Wind is a structured reinvention framework designed for adults navigating identity evolution and meaningful transition.
Awareness
Naming where you are and what is shifting in your internal landscape.
Release
Making space by loosening what no longer fits your current evolution.
Realignment
Reorienting your choices and boundaries with your deeper values.
Reinvention
Designing the next chapter with intention, architecting your new story.
Momentum
Walking out a sustainable and intentional path forward into the future.
